Reduction in working hours. In relation to the application of the hirer’s remuneration as referred to in article 20, the temporary agency worker is entitled to the same reduction in working hours per week/month/year/period as that applying for employees of the user company working in the same or equivalent job as the temporary agency worker. The applicable reduction in working hours may, at the private employment agency’s discretion, be compensated in time and/or money.

  • Reduction in Hours (a) Reduction in hours shall be based on seniority, providing that affected employees have the qualifications to perform the work that is available and that licensing standards can be maintained. (b) Any regular employee offered a reduction of hours shall have the right to choose layoff as per Article 13.3. (c) Any regular employee offered a reduction of hours shall be given two (2) weeks’ notice of the reduction.
